R-相热处理镍钛根管锉的力学性能和根管预备成形能力 被引量:3

Mechanical properties and shaping ability of R-phase heat treatment nickel-titanium instruments

摘要 镍钛根管锉在根管治疗中的应用越来越广泛,为了提高镍钛根管锉的机械性能,R-相热处理技术被应用于其生产加工。本文对R-相热处理镍钛根管锉的制造工艺、弯曲性能、疲劳性能、扭转性能及预备成形能力等方面进行综述。 Nickel-titanium rotary instrument has been widely used in endodontic practice. Recently, R-phase heat treatment technique has been used in the manufacture of files to improve its mechanical properties. This article provides a review on manufacturing process, bending property, cyclic fatigue resistance, torsional resistance, and shaping ability of R-phase nickel-titanium instruments.
